______ are generally accepted so broadly within a community that they are considered self-evident and largely go unquestioned.

Social Studies
1 answer:
shutvik [7]1 year ago
4 0

<u>C. </u><u>Moral values</u> are generally accepted so broadly within a community that they are considered self-evident and largely go unquestioned.

<h3>What are moral values?</h3>

Moral values are the guiding principles that assist one when making choices.

Moral values help us to create honest, credible, and fair judgments of our actions.

Without embracing moral values, some people will misbehave.

Some of the societal moral values include:

  • Loving and helping one's family
  • Returning favors
  • Being brave
  • Deferring to superiors
  • Sharing resources fairly
  • Being kind and caring
  • Respecting others' property.

Thus, moral values and not ethical dilemmas or social values are considered self-evident in every society.

In a study that researched the effects of different types of information on memory, subjects viewed a slide presentation of a tr
Dominik [7]

Answer:

A). Subjects who were given misleading information after viewing the slides were far less accurate in their memories for the kind of sign present than were subjects who were given no such information.

Explanation:

As per the given example, option A displays the results or consequences of the given study which researched the 'impacts of various types of information on human memory'. The results would reveal that 'subjects who were offered misleading information were less correct in their memories in comparison to the subjects who were not proffered with any such information' as the wrong or misinformation leads to form inaccurate or false memories in their mind which implies that 'memories can not be reliable'. Therefore, <u>option A</u> is the correct answer.
